Dockerfile可以便捷的建立一個(gè)image,它可以在一個(gè)鏡像基礎(chǔ)上,去構(gòu)建另一個(gè)鏡像,這也許就是它的特色,也是docker的本意! 我們下載一個(gè)mono的鏡像 docker pull mon
通常,我們首先定義Dockerfile文件,然后通過docker build命令構(gòu)建得到鏡像文件。然后,才能夠基于鏡像文件通過docker run啟動(dòng)一個(gè)容器的實(shí)例。 那么在啟動(dòng)一個(gè)容器的時(shí)候,就可以
本文提要 本文目的不僅僅是創(chuàng)建一個(gè)MySQL的鏡像,而是在其基礎(chǔ)上再實(shí)現(xiàn)啟動(dòng)過程中自動(dòng)導(dǎo)入數(shù)據(jù)及數(shù)據(jù)庫用戶的權(quán)限設(shè)置,并且在新創(chuàng)建出來的容器里自動(dòng)啟動(dòng)MySQL服務(wù)接受外部連接,主要是通過Docker
編寫 Dockerfile 以 express 自動(dòng)創(chuàng)建的目錄為例,目錄結(jié)構(gòu)如下: ├── /bin │ └── www ├── /node_modules ├── /public ├── /r
導(dǎo)讀 Kubernetes要從容器化開始,而容器又需要從Dockerfile開始,本文將介紹如何寫出一個(gè)優(yōu)雅的Dockerfile文件。 文章主要內(nèi)容包括: Docker容器
在本章節(jié)中將和大家講解:Dockerfile的第二部分: Dockerfile FROM 指令 主要作用是指定一個(gè)鏡像作為構(gòu)建自定義鏡像的基礎(chǔ)鏡像,在這個(gè)基礎(chǔ)鏡像之上進(jìn)行修改定制。 這個(gè)指令是 D
Dockerfile常用指令 1.FROM:構(gòu)建鏡像基于哪個(gè)鏡像 語法:FROM [:] 例如:FROM centos:7 解釋:設(shè)置要制作的鏡像基于哪
在前一篇文章: Docker入門系列之一:在一個(gè)Docker容器里運(yùn)行指定的web應(yīng)用 里, 我們已經(jīng)成功地將我們?cè)诒镜亻_發(fā)的一個(gè)web應(yīng)用部署到Docker容器里運(yùn)行。 本
對(duì)于docker用戶來說,最好的情況是不需要自己創(chuàng)建鏡像,幾乎所有的常用的數(shù)據(jù)庫、中間件、應(yīng)用軟件等都有現(xiàn)成的docker官方鏡像或其他人和組織創(chuàng)建的鏡像,我們只需要稍微配置就可以直接使用。但是在某些
Docker 鏡像創(chuàng)建方法 Docker鏡像創(chuàng)建方法 創(chuàng)建鏡像的方法有三種,分別是基于已有的鏡像創(chuàng)建、基于本地模板創(chuàng)建、基于Dockerfile 創(chuàng)建,下面著重介紹這三種創(chuàng)建鏡像的方法。 一、基